abstract = "For being an area of agricultural frontier, the Bahias Cerrado has
undergone intense landscape transformations. The objective of this
article is to demonstrate the effect of conversion of natural
areas in agricultural activities, in the spatial configuration of
the landscape in the sub-basin of river Riach{\~a}o. Satellite
images TM - Landsat 5 (1980 - 2010) were used to map the remaining
natural fragments and then was held an intersection between
fragment size and slope for obtaining homogeneous cells and then
determine landscape metrics, by extending Path Analyst 5.0,
available for ArcGIS 9.3 software. There was an increase in the
metric NP (26%), followed by a reduction of MPS (89%), TCA (85.7%)
and TCAI (40%) class \≥ 300 (0 - 3%). This result reveals
the susceptibility of the fragments to the edge effect, especially
for greater interference matrix (crop), which implies lower
environmental quality fragments to landscape structure integrity
maintenance, over the thirty years of use and occupation soil. At
the same time, the sub-basin also features 293fragments with MPS
of 73 ha (2010), which is equivalent to an area of 21,371 ha, very
valuable for environmental conservation activities, especially
because present median complexity fragments (MPFD), though its
elongated shapes (MSI).",
